Search Vacancies

Product Manager

Business Role Type
Business Support Role
Business Support Departments
Travel Insurance
Location
Cardiff
External Closing Date
29/03/2019

This vacancy has now expired, and is not accepting any new applications.

Please search for live opportunities or use the Register Interest facility to sign up for job alerts and/or leave your CV speculatively.

Job Purpose

This is an exciting role which involves being part of Admiral’s Travel Insurance team to support the growth and development of a new product.

Working with multiple areas of the business, you will be responsible for key projects, manage various relationships with different stakeholders and provide general day-to-day support to the department.

Overall aims of the role

  • Monitor market trends and developments to ensure the product is still competitive
  • Work with the rest of the Travel Insurance team to ensure that the product suite is up to date, innovative and meeting customer expectations and needs
  • Analyse customers complaints to suggest product and customer experience improvements
  • Review claims repudiation and withdrawal rates to monitor whether the product meets customers needs
  • Proactively identify potential business risks within the Travel Insurance product area and manage controls for these risks
  • Have a good understanding of, and work closely with, all operational areas including Travel Claims to help maximise value for the Travel business
  • Be responsible for the relevant management information and the communication to peers and senior management alike
  • Identify new areas of growth for Travel, related insurance products and add-ons
  • React to audits conducted to ensure product is sold and marketed compliantly

Skills and attitudes required

  • Must be an effective communicator, able to work with and develop fellow team members
  • Experienced in stakeholder management, including third party relationships
  • Able to assess the potential impact of emerging issues and opportunities and how to apply them in a business context
  • Be confident in numerical analysis and reporting
  • Have or gain an understanding of the operational areas
  • Should be knowledgeable but also open to new ideas and options to innovate
  • Good knowledge of the Travel Insurance market would be beneficial

The Recruitment Officer looking after this role is Linzi.Burnell@admiralgroup.co.uk

Our success goes hand-in-hand with having a strong culture where we put our people and customers first. Our philosophy is simple yet effective: people who like what they do, do it better, and this in turn, means that our customers receive the level of service and products that they deserve. Our culture is honest, open and wholeheartedly focused on four key areas: Communication, Equality, Reward & Recognition, and Fun.

At Admiral, we are proud to be a diverse business where we put our people and customers first. We understand that a good work life balance is important, and we want you to have an element of freedom to define a working lifestyle that supports this. We are happy to talk about flexible working. Please contact us for more information.

 

 

 

#LI-LP1